Primary Duties & Responsibilities:
Works closely with internal clients and marketing team members to assist in the execution of marketing plans that support an engagement strategy that drives relationship building.
Executes on tactics as defined in marketing plans. Following a defined creative process, manage projects that will include a multitude of channels and supporting materials. Develops timelines, budgets and execution of deliverables, including obtaining the appropriate approvals. Deliverables of projects may include signage, collateral, website content, events, emails, letters, newsletters, and promotions.
Assists in research and analysis of engagement strategies and initiatives.
Coordinates with cross-functional teams to gather necessary information and ensure alignment with project objectives. Responsible for maintaining, updating, and aligning multiple projects at a single time to meet deadlines and update project management software accordingly for Communications & Engagement Team.
Performs other duties as assigned.
